Markdown pipeline runbook — Ferngate renderer. If preview output is blank, check the Slateroot sanitizer stage first; it silently drops documents over 2MB. Restart the worker pool, then replay the failed queue from the Mirrowell dashboard. Do not clear the cache unless rendering errors persist after replay. Escalate to the Ferngate on-call if replay loops twice. Verification requires the trace token from the last successful replay, shown below.

trace token, yahif-kagep: htk31_bd0cc6b1d7ab4f7094c586a5de900e0

**Q: How does Fernquist Survey's offline mode protect cached responses?**

A: When connectivity drops, the app encrypts queued survey submissions with a device-local key derived from the team's recovery passphrase. Reviewers checking the sync module should verify that decryption only occurs after the passphrase is re-entered post-reconnect. For the staging test device, the passphrase to use is below.

vault phrase of tawig-taduf = zorath-oliwyn

## Step 4: Configure RampGate

RampGate controls percentage-based rollouts for all customer-facing flags. After deploying the control plane, the evaluator pods need their admin credential or they will serve stale flag snapshots and refuse writes. Verify the pods are healthy first, then rotate the credential using the standard rotation script. Do not reuse the previous environment's value; each cluster gets its own. Once rotated, append this line to the evaluator env file to complete the step.

vault entry, yahif-yajep: COURIER_KEY29=b802bdf8034096b65a51c6ba5abe2

Action item: The Relayn deploy-status bot silently dropped updates when the pipeline API paginated results, so responders believed a rollback had completed when it had not. We will add pagination handling, a staleness banner, and an integration test. Until merged, verify deploy state directly in the pipeline console, documented at the page below.

runbook for kahop-kajop: https://rundeck.ordinio.test/display/secrets/pipeline/issue/pages/repo/browse/e5732776e07d1285107e5aeb